Output 62f3c90c807d1ea3d2e0216251969a80640a0e9b1dbb47475807d3b3ed0485b2:0

value
39837367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3c2dc0bf388b5cba698a9e4b5f24926766473f OP_EQUAL
address
3EkNeGQYFNz9Ge5QctENV2JLpGdQTfoqqE
transaction
62f3c90c807d1ea3d2e0216251969a80640a0e9b1dbb47475807d3b3ed0485b2
spent
true